Liverpool have conducted stunning transfer business so far this summer. Reds fans can be very excited about the imminent arrivals of Jeremie Frimpong, Florian Wirtz, Milos Kerkez and Giorgi Mamardashvili.

But sporting director Richard Hughes and head coach Arne Slot won’t stop there. An upgrade is also on the cards in the striker department.


OneFootball Videos


Darwin Nunez hasn’t convinced Slot throughout his time at the club so far - and looks set for an exit to Napoli if the two sides can soon come to an agreement.

Diogo Jota too is under some threat. His contract expires in 2027 and Liverpool may opt to cash in on the injury-prone Portuguese.

Liverpool need a new No9

The next phase of Liverpool’s transfer plans will require significant outgoings - following on from a near £200m outlay on new players.

And if Liverpool receive the money they seek for Nunez then the proceeds could be immediately ploughed into a replacement.

We’ve seen links to Alexander Isak, Hugo Ekitike, Victor Osimhen and Joao Pedro. To that list we can add one more player in the shape of Viktor Gyokeres.

That’s according to a new report from the Correio da Manha, which claims the Reds have entered the race for the wantaway Sporting CP striker.

Sporting want €80m for Gyokeres

Sporting rejected Arsenal’s opening offer for the Swede and the player is said to be downcast at the thought of missing out on a move.

The Portuguese champions are said to be holding out for €80m for the 27-year-old - and the report adds that Liverpool have no intention of paying that amount.

But with Isak going for north of £100m, this price might well be judged as reasonable for a marksman who scored 39 goals in 33 league games last season.
